Date, Banana and Walnut Loaf

  • DifficultyEasy
  • Prep0:10
  • Cook0:45
  • Serves 6

Very moist, healthy, sugarless loaf cake, best sliced and spread with butter to serve. Also freezes very well. Can be doubled and one frozen for later. - susannemcdonald

Ingredients

  • 1 cup water
  • 2 tbs butter
  • 1 cup dates diced
  • 1 tsp mixed spice
  • 1 tsp bicarbonate of soda
  • 2 egg
  • 1 cup wholemeal self-raising flour
  • 2 banana mashed ripe
  • 1/2 cup walnuts chopped
  • 1/2 tsp ground cinnamon

Method

  • Step 1
    Preheat oven to 165C fan-forced.
  • Step 2
    Place water, dates, butter and spice in large saucepan and heat to boiling point, stir until butter is melted.
  • Step 3
    Remove from heat and add bicarbonate of soda.
  • Step 4
    Allow to cool to room temperature and then add bananas, eggs, nuts, flour and cinnamon.

  • Step 5
    Stir well and pour into a greased and lined loaf pan.
  • Step 6
    Bake for approximately 45 minutes or until a skewer inserted comes out clean.
  • Step 7
    Allow to rest in tin for 20 minutes before turning out.

Equipment

  • 1 loaf pan
Recipe Notes

You can use white self-raising flour if desired.
